MURALS:

Boston Wharf: This wall of light is a constantly changing play of light and color.  The individual 1.5 by 2.8 meter glass panels are flooded with shafts and rays of light that process through a multiple hour cycle.  The work appears static as you pass through the lobby space, yet is different each time one sees it.

Making use of existing wall wash fixtures and retro-fitting with custom
optics, frees the architect to build and utilize long wall areas
decoratively. The flexibility and durability of "off the shelf" hardware
fitted with specific optical devices designed to site specifics creates a
hard hitting and dramatic effect in otherwise mundane settings.
